Octupuses, Squid, Crustaceans, Spiders And Some Molluscs Have Blue Blood Because It Contains A Protein Called Haemocyanin.

Currently voted the best answer. Brachiopods also have dark blood. Bugs, like most arthropods, have an open circulatory system, they don’t have genuine blood or veins.

This Molecule, Instead Of Having An Atom Of Iron In Its Middle, Has An Atom Of Copper That Binds Oxygen.
